It's official: Ohio redistricting amendment makes November ballot. What would it do? by ashrak94 in Conservative

[–]ashrak94[S] 2 points3 points  (0 children)

Submission title from article.

Just as the abortion and marijuana amendments boosted turnout in 2022, this has the same potential for November.

The key change is removing proportional representation on the redistricting commission from the Ohio legislature and replacing it with 5 Republicans, 5 Democrats, and 5 independents. This amendment came after the Republican led commission submitted maps were repeatedly rejected by the Ohio Supreme Court for being unfairly biased.

Weird question but is there an easy way to make a small batch of “soap scum”? by Silent_Count_6177 in AskChemistry

[–]ashrak94 1 point2 points  (0 children)

Calcium Stearate.

Purchase on amazon or combine calcium hydroxide and stearic acid. Your soap is going to have a large portion of glycerin, but you should be able to add calcium chloride (damp rid or sidewalk deicer) to precipitate out your desired soap scum. Be sure to use as little agitation as possible, calcium stearate is used to stabilize emulsions.
